Understanding BIFMA Level Certification in Israel:
For businesses in Israel seeking to make their mark in the sustainable furniture market, BIFMA Level Certification offers a clear roadmap. The certification evaluates products based on their environmental performance, social responsibility, and economic impact throughout their life cycle. Each level signifies an increasing level of sustainability achievement, from level 1 to level 3, with level 3 being the most rigorous standard to attain. By understanding the criteria and requirements of BIFMA Level Certification, companies can align their practices with sustainable principles.
Steps to Obtain BIFMA Level Certification:
4.1. Conducting a Sustainability Assessment:
The first step towards BIFMA Level Certification involves conducting a thorough sustainability assessment of the furniture manufacturing process. This assessment should identify areas where sustainable practices can be implemented, such as reducing energy consumption, using eco-friendly materials, and minimizing waste generation. Businesses should also evaluate their supply chain and ensure that suppliers align with sustainable values.
4.2. Implementing Sustainable Practices:
After identifying opportunities for improvement, businesses must implement sustainable practices within their operations. This may involve adopting renewable energy sources, optimizing production processes, and exploring innovative ways to reduce environmental impact. Additionally, companies should prioritize the use of materials with eco-friendly certifications and explore recycling and circular economy initiatives.
4.3. Submitting Documentation for Certification:
To obtain BIFMA Level Certification, companies must compile comprehensive documentation detailing their sustainability efforts. This documentation will be reviewed by BIFMA to assess the company’s compliance with the certification criteria. It is essential to provide transparent and accurate data, backed by evidence and supported by responsible management practices.
